SEQUENCE-ANALYSIS OF A-9873 BP FRAGMENT OF THE LEFT ARM OF YEAST CHROMOSOME-XV THAT CONTAINS THE ARG8 AND CDC33 GENES, A PUTATIVE RIBOFLAVIN SYNTHASE BETA-CHAIN GENE, AND 4 NEW OPEN READING FRAMES
C. Casas et al., SEQUENCE-ANALYSIS OF A-9873 BP FRAGMENT OF THE LEFT ARM OF YEAST CHROMOSOME-XV THAT CONTAINS THE ARG8 AND CDC33 GENES, A PUTATIVE RIBOFLAVIN SYNTHASE BETA-CHAIN GENE, AND 4 NEW OPEN READING FRAMES, Yeast, 11(11), 1995, pp. 1061-1067
The DNA sequence of a 9873 bp fragment located near the left telomere
of chromosome XV has been determined. Sequence analysis reveals seven
open reading frames. One is the ARG8 gene coding for N-acetylornithine
aminotransferase. Another corresponds to CDC33, which codes for the i
nitiation factor 4E or cap binding protein. The open reading frame AOE
169 can be considered as the putative gene for the Saccharomyces cerev
isiae riboflavin synthase beta chain, since its translation product sh
ows strong homology with four prokaryotic riboflavin synthase beta cha
ins. The nucleotide sequence reported here has been submitted to the E
MBL data library under the Accession Number X84036.
